CEPA: What Nigeria stands to gain in trade deal with UAE

Today marks a historic milestone in Nigeria’s trade relations. The Federal Republic of Nigeria and the United Arab Emirates signed a Comprehensive Economic Partnership Agreement CEPA that will transform economic ties between our two nations and deliver tangible benefits for Nigerian businesses, professionals, and workers. This Agreement is the product of focused and determined negotiations led by the Federal Ministry of Industry, Trade and Investment under the direction of the Honourable Minister and Chief Negotiator for Nigeria, Jumoke Oduwole. Kano govt begins probe into patient’s death

The Kano State Hospitals Management Board has ordered an investigation into alleged negligence following the death of a patient, Aishatu Umar, at the Abubakar Imam Urology Centre in Kano. The Executive Secretary of the Board, Dr Mansur Nagoda, directed that an immediate probe be conducted into the circumstances surrounding the incident, amid growing public concern. A statement issued on Tuesday by the board’s Public Relations Officer, Mrs Samira Suleiman, said the management had taken note of reports describing the circumstances of the death as distressing. ₦311bn laundering: ICPC drags El-Rufai’s associate to court

The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Offences Commission has arraigned Amadu Sule, Managing Director of TMDK Terminal Limited and an associate of former Kaduna State Governor, Nasir el-Rufai, over an alleged ₦311 billion money laundering scheme. Sule was arraigned on Monday before the Federal High Court sitting in Kaduna on a five-count charge bordering on money laundering and unlawful retention of proceeds of fraud, contrary to the Money Laundering (Prevention and Prohibition) Act, 2022. Terrorists Kill Four, Set Shops Ablaze in Niger State Attack

The Niger State Police Command has confirmed the killing of four people and the setting ablaze of shops by terrorists in the state. The terrorists invaded Damala village in Woko District of Borgu Local Government Area on Saturday in an attack that occurred in the early hours of the day, causing panic as residents ran in different directions in search of safety. A source in the community said an undisclosed number of residents were also abducted during the attack. Jurgen Klopp Linked with Real Madrid Head Coach Role

Former Liverpool manager Jürgen Klopp has emerged as a potential candidate for the Real Madrid head coach position should the Spanish giants decide to appoint a new manager ahead of the summer. Real Madrid are currently under the temporary leadership of Álvaro Arbeloa following the departure of Xabi Alonso, who stepped down from his role on Monday after less than eight months in charge. Klopp is presently working as Head of Global Soccer at Red Bull, a role he assumed in January 2025 after leaving Liverpool at the end of the 2023/24 season.
